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Update von v2.0.5.1 rev 12725 auf 2.0.6 weisse Seite

    zuechner

    • Neu im Forum
    • Beiträge: 15
    Hallo,

    ich wollte meinen shop. www.veti-shop.de so langsam mal auf die aktuellste Version aktualisieren Derzeit Version 2.0.5.1 rev 12725. Wenn ich das passende update ausführe, funktioniert ohne Fehlermeldung wird danach nur noch eine weiße Seite angezeigt, wenn ich den Schop aufrufe, im Frontend, sowie im Backend.

    Php Version 7.4.33
    templat ist das revplus in der Version vom 23.12,2020.

    Hat jemand eine Idee?

    Vielen Dank im Voraus.

    Linkback: https://www.modified-shop.org/forum/index.php?topic=43364.0

    Dampfliquids

    • Neu im Forum
    • Beiträge: 46
    • Geschlecht:
    Re: Update von v2.0.5.1 rev 12725 auf 2.0.6 weisse Seite
    Antwort #1 am: 21. März 2024, 20:07:09
    Hallo, wollte meine auch updaten auf 2.0.6 habe auch das gleiche Problem. Bei mir stand zuerst php Version ab 7.4 . Habe es gemacht danach die Weisse Seite. Kann den installer nicht aufrufen.Kann auch nicht in den Adminbereich. Bei FTP Übertragung per Filezilla konnten manche Datein nicht übertragen werden. Habs wiederholt aber trotzdem nicht übertragbar. Vielleicht weiss jemand wie man es lösen kann.
    Lg

    Timm

    • Fördermitglied
    • Beiträge: 6.255
    Re: Update von v2.0.5.1 rev 12725 auf 2.0.6 weisse Seite
    Antwort #2 am: 21. März 2024, 21:35:26
    Moin

    Es ist keine gute Idee von 2.0.5.1 auf 2.0.6.0 upzudaten. Das war eine der Versionen mit den meisten Bugs.

    Entweder auf 2.0.7.2 updaten, weil vielleicht bestimmte Drittmodule noch nicht mit 3.0.2 funktionieren, ansonsten gleich auf die 3.0.2.

    Das ist am Ende nicht viel mehr Arbeit. Von Version zu Version dauert viel länger.

    Ansonsten würden Logfiles bei Problemen helfen.

    @zuechner
    Das Template ist von Stand 2020 und die 2.0.6.0 wurde 2021 veröffentlicht. Insofern sind da nicht alle Neuerungen drin. Schalte mal auf ein Standardtemplate. Wenn es dann geht, weißt du, dass du eine neuere Templateversion benötigst. Oder pflegst das selbst alles ein. Ist aber viel Arbeit.

    Template eines xt:Commerce Shops in der modified eCommerce Shopsoftware weiter verwenden

    Gruß Timm

    Dampfliquids

    • Neu im Forum
    • Beiträge: 46
    • Geschlecht:
    Re: Update von v2.0.5.1 rev 12725 auf 2.0.6 weisse Seite
    Antwort #3 am: 21. März 2024, 21:59:18
    Du meinst wir sollten direkt auf die Neuerste updaten? Sollte es nicht immer mit der eine höhere version passieren? Wenn es so geht kann ich es auch versuchen natürlich . Ich kann momentan nicht auf Admin zugreifen.

    Timm

    • Fördermitglied
    • Beiträge: 6.255
    Re: Update von v2.0.5.1 rev 12725 auf 2.0.6 weisse Seite
    Antwort #4 am: 21. März 2024, 22:25:11
    Ja bei so vielen Shopversionen dazwischen, ist es nicht viel aufwendiger, da bestimmte Dateien in jeder Shopversion angepasst wurden und du sie dadurch  nur einmal anpassen musst und nicht mehrfach. Sind insgesamt mehr Dateien anzupassen, aber da du viele nicht doppelt anpassen musst, macht es am Ende weniger Arbeit.

    Und dann nur den neuesten _installer ausführen und der erkennt automatisch welche DB Updates ausgeführt werden müssen.

    Von 2.0.5.1 zu 3.0.2 müsstest du bei Update auf jede Zwischenversion auch 7mal alle Dateien vergleichen, anpassen auf eigene Änderungen, dann per ftp die Dateien hochladen und 7mal den _installer ausführen. Dann lieber einmal 2.0.5.1 gegen 3.0.2 auf eigene Änderungen vergleichen und das ganze nur einmal machen.

    Gruß Timm

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.868
    • Geschlecht:
    Re: Update von v2.0.5.1 rev 12725 auf 2.0.6 weisse Seite
    Antwort #5 am: 22. März 2024, 10:11:48
    Wichtig dabei ist nur, dass man bei einer solchen dann erstmal ein "Gesamtupdatepaket" erstellt.
    Dabei muss man dann erstmal alle Updatepakete nacheinander in einen Ordner kopieren, so dass dort am Ende dann die neuesten Daten als Paket vorliegen. Dieses dann hochladen.

    Die Updatepakete müssen natürlich alle korrekt enthalten sein und alle Pakete enthalten, welche zwischen der eigenen Version und der, welche man am Ende haben will liegen. Wenn man das dann schon mal macht, dann natürlich dann direkt die neueste Version.

    Also in etwa wie folgt:
    rausfinden, welche Version man selber einsetzt, das findet man gut in den Credits im Shop-Backend oben rechts:
    [ Für Gäste sind keine Dateianhänge sichtbar ]
    da steht dann deine aktuelle Version
    [ Für Gäste sind keine Dateianhänge sichtbar ]

    Danach die entsprechenden Updates raussuchen.

    Beispiel: die aktuelle Version wäre 2.0.5.0
    Dann lädst du diese Updates runter:
    Update 2.0.5.0 rev 12487 zu 2.0.5.1 rev 12725
    Update 2.0.5.1 rev 12725 zu 2.0.6.0 rev 13500
    Update 2.0.6.0 rev 13500 zu 2.0.7.0 rev 14473
    Update 2.0.7.0 rev 14473 zu 2.0.7.1 rev 14605
    Update 2.0.7.1 rev 14605 zu 2.0.7.2 rev 14622
    Update 2.0.7.2 rev 14622 zu 3.0.0 rev 15588
    Update 3.0.0 rev 15588 zu 3.0.1 rev 15696
    Update 3.0.1 rev 15696 zu 3.0.2 rev 15701

    Und nun entpackst du diese der korrekten Reihenfolge nach in einen Ordner. Genau in der oben angegebenen Reihenfolge, von deiner Version aus startend und dann immer das nächsthöhere Paket.

    Das hat den Vorteil wenn z.B. Datei "xyz.php" in Update 2.0.6.0 rev 13500 zu 2.0.7.0 rev 14473 enthalten ist, und dann erneut in Update 2.0.7.1 rev 14605 zu 2.0.7.2 rev 14622 und zu guter letzt nochmals in Update 3.0.1 rev 15696 zu 3.0.2 rev 15701 du am Ende definitiv die korrekte & neueste Datei hast.

    Und wie Timm sagt, hast du die dann nicht dreimal angepackt, sondern eben nur am Ende einmal.

    Sofern natürlich eigenhändig vorgenommene Dateiänderungen in bestimmten Core-Dateien vorliegen, muss man das nochmals manuell kontrollieren und erneut einbauen. Sofern das nicht der Fall ist. kann man das ganze Paket einfach hochladen.
    Nur beim Template sollte man eben auch nochmals aufpassen bevor man das einfach so hochlädt, sofern man dieses, mit ziemlicher Wahrscheinlichkeit, irgendwo mal verändert hatte.

    Wenn man ein Standardtemplate von modified verwendet, ist das aber auch kein Hexenwerk:
    dann vergleicht man mit Winmerge oder ähnlichem (Dateivergleichsprogramm) einmal das Template aus seiner aktuellen Version mit dem eigenen auf dem FTP:
    man lädt das Komplettpaket der eigenen aktuellen Version runter, in unserem Beispiel 2.0.5.0
    Nun vergleicht man über das genannte Programm mit seinem eigenen, welches man einmalig vom FTP runterlädt (damit man auch wirklich das ganz aktuelle von sich hat).

    Wenn ich dann also z.B. an 10 Stellen Unterschiede entdecke, dann muss ich diese nachträglich dann auch wieder im Updatepaket entsprechend anpassen.

    Dann wie in der Anleitung die Datenbankupdates / -optimierungen etc. durchführen und schwupps:
    man hat eine aktuelle Version ;)

    Viele Grüße
    Dominik
    15 Antworten
    4362 Aufrufe
    14. November 2016, 18:24:29 von ShopNix
    7 Antworten
    1529 Aufrufe
    02. Juni 2022, 07:59:49 von Karl1
    13 Antworten
    12790 Aufrufe
    05. November 2018, 12:49:15 von Rubi
    4 Antworten
    3537 Aufrufe
    26. August 2016, 14:31:29 von maikl